Price Comparison

When considering pricing, the AKASO Brave 4 Pro is about 45% cheaper than the Xtra Edge Action Camera. The Brave 4 Pro is priced at $109.99, while the Xtra Edge comes in at $199.00. This significant price difference may sway budget-conscious buyers towards the AKASO option, especially for those who are looking for a reliable action camera without breaking the bank. The lower price of the Brave 4 Pro could also make it an appealing choice for beginners who may not want to invest heavily in their first action camera.

Camera Quality and Sensor

In terms of camera quality, the Xtra Edge Action Camera features a larger 1/1.3” sensor, which is designed to capture richer detail and vibrant colors, making it well-suited for vlogging and landscape photography. The AKASO Brave 4 Pro, on the other hand, offers 4K30FPS video resolution and captures 20MP photos. While the Brave 4 Pro delivers impressive video quality and clarity, the advanced sensor technology of the Xtra Edge may provide an edge in challenging lighting conditions. Thus, for those prioritizing high-quality visuals, the Xtra Edge may be the better choice.

Image Stabilization

The Xtra Edge Action Camera boasts hyper stabilization, ensuring smooth video capture even during high-motion activities like biking or running. The AKASO Brave 4 Pro features built-in Electronic Image Stabilization (EIS) 2.0, which also aims to keep footage stable. While both cameras claim to minimize shaky footage, the Xtra Edge’s hyper stabilization may offer a slight advantage for extreme sports enthusiasts. However, both options provide solid stabilization features that enhance the overall viewing experience.

Waterproof Capabilities

The AKASO Brave 4 Pro is waterproof up to 131 feet, which is significantly deeper than the Xtra Edge’s waterproof rating of 52 feet. This makes the Brave 4 Pro a more suitable option for underwater filming, such as scuba diving or snorkeling. For users who plan on taking their camera on more extreme aquatic adventures, the AKASO Brave 4 Pro provides a greater level of protection. The additional waterproof depth could be a deciding factor for those who frequently engage in water sports.

Accessories and Usability

The AKASO Brave 4 Pro comes with a valuable accessories kit, including a USB dual charger, remote control wristband, and various mounts compatible with most cameras, including GoPro. This comprehensive bundle adds value and convenience, especially for beginners. In contrast, the Xtra Edge Action Camera includes a standard bundle with a dual-facing mount adapter and a protective frame, but it may not be as extensive as the Brave 4 Pro’s offering. Users looking for a more complete package right out of the box might lean towards the AKASO option.
